Why it's worth checking out

Wappa Falls Astronomical Observatory offers astronomy experiences in a quiet, dark bushland setting near Peregian Beach on the Sunshine Coast. Its programmes are designed to be humorous, informative and suitable for all ages, making the observatory a practical option for families, school groups and visitors with an interest in space. The venue also says it caters for special needs groups.

The observatory has 16 telescopes in different sizes, giving visitors the chance to explore the night sky through guided viewing. Its night-time show includes telescope viewing, a tour of the sky, an indoor display, a talk and a slideshow. There is still plenty to see when clouds or rain prevent outdoor observing, with indoor activities forming an important part of the experience.

Daytime visits focus on the Sun and space from a different angle. Ten telescopes are fitted with six different filtering systems for safe solar viewing, and the programme includes indoor presentations, a meteorite collection and a space walk. The site specifically warns that the Sun should never be viewed without the proper equipment, so visitors should follow the observatory’s guidance rather than attempting this themselves.

The observatory has more than 50 years of astronomy experience and has operated for over 27 years. It also takes its astronomy programme on the road to schools, camps and other events across the Sunshine Coast, surrounding areas, Brisbane and beyond, bringing telescopes, displays and slideshows to groups that cannot visit the site. With its mix of guided observation, practical displays and weather-independent indoor activities, it suits curious first-timers as well as dedicated astronomy enthusiasts, whether visiting as a family, group or individual.
